PHP,作为一种广泛使用的服务器端脚本语言,最初并不被视作前端技术。然而,在Web开发领域,PHP却在前端开发中扮演着重要角色。本文将揭秘PHP为何既不是纯前端技术,却能在前端开发中如此流行。PHP的...
PHP,作为一种广泛使用的服务器端脚本语言,最初并不被视作前端技术。然而,在Web开发领域,PHP却在前端开发中扮演着重要角色。本文将揭秘PHP为何既不是纯前端技术,却能在前端开发中如此流行。
PHP诞生于1994年,最初是为了生成动态网页而设计。随着Web技术的发展,PHP逐渐从纯后端脚本语言演变为一种可以在服务器端处理HTML、CSS和JavaScript等前端技术的语言。
尽管PHP主要应用于后端开发,但它在以下方面对前端开发产生了深远影响:
PHP语法简单,入门门槛低,使得许多开发者可以快速掌握PHP前端开发。
PHP提供了丰富的库和框架,如Laravel、Symfony等,可以帮助开发者提高开发效率。
PHP拥有庞大的开发者社区,提供了丰富的学习资源和解决方案。
PHP是一种开源语言,无需购买昂贵的软件许可证,降低了开发成本。
相比于其他前端技术,如JavaScript,PHP在处理大量数据时可能会出现性能问题。
在PHP前端开发中,如果代码结构不合理,可能会导致代码维护困难。
PHP本身具有一定的安全隐患,如SQL注入、XSS攻击等,需要开发者注意防范。
尽管存在一些挑战,但PHP在前端开发中的地位仍然不可忽视。随着技术的不断发展,PHP在前端开发中的应用将会越来越广泛。
PHP可以与多种前端技术集成,实现跨平台开发,满足不同平台和设备的需求。
随着人工智能技术的发展,PHP将更好地与人工智能技术结合,为前端开发带来更多可能性。
PHP框架将持续优化,提高开发效率和性能,降低开发成本。
总之,PHP虽然不是纯前端技术,但在前端开发中发挥着重要作用。随着技术的不断发展,PHP将在前端开发领域继续扮演重要角色。